Kursdetails

โ€ข Fourier's Law of Heat Conduction: Understanding the fundamental principle that describes how heat energy is transferred through a solid material due to a temperature difference.
โ€ข Thermal Conductivity: Exploring the property of a material that determines its ability to conduct heat, and how to measure and calculate it.
โ€ข One-Dimensional Heat Conduction: Learning the mathematical models and techniques used to analyze heat conduction in a single direction.
โ€ข Multi-Dimensional Heat Conduction: Extending the concepts of one-dimensional heat conduction to cases where heat is flowing in multiple directions.
โ€ข Heat Equation: Deriving and analyzing the partial differential equation that governs heat conduction in solids, and solving it for various geometric configurations.
โ€ข Boundary Conditions: Understanding the types of boundary conditions that arise in heat conduction problems and how to apply them in solution methods.
โ€ข Transient Heat Conduction: Analyzing the time-dependent behavior of heat conduction, including the concept of thermal diffusivity.
โ€ข Heat Conduction in Composite Materials: Modeling and analyzing heat conduction through materials with different thermal properties.
โ€ข Numerical Methods for Heat Conduction: Learning the computational techniques used to solve complex heat conduction problems, including finite difference and finite element methods.
โ€ข Applications of Heat Conduction: Examining real-world examples of heat conduction in engineering, physics, and materials science.
